Product Overview: TLV2452IDGKR by Texas Instruments
The TLV2452IDGKR is a state-of-the-art operational amplifier (op-amp) from Texas Instruments, designed for a broad range of applications. This high-performance device is known for its low-power consumption and rail-to-rail input/output swing. Packaged in an 8-pin MSOP (DGK) package, it is suitable for space-constrained applications while offering robust features that make it a versatile choice for designers.
Key Features
- Low Power Consumption: With a quiescent current of just 500 µA per channel, the TLV2452IDGKR is an ideal choice for battery-powered and low-power systems.
- Rail-to-Rail Input/Output: The op-amp features rail-to-rail input and output swing, which allows for the full range of input and output to be used, maximizing signal dynamic range.
- Wide Bandwidth: It offers a bandwidth of 220 kHz, which is well-suited for audio processing, low-frequency sensors, and other applications that require a wide bandwidth.
- Supply Voltage Range: The device operates over a wide supply voltage range from 2.7 V to 6 V, providing flexibility in various circuit designs.
- Low Noise: It provides a low noise density of 25 nV/√Hz at 1 kHz, ensuring high signal integrity for precision applications.
Applications
The TLV2452IDGKR is adept for a multitude of applications including:
- Portable and battery-powered devices
- Sensor signal conditioning
- Medical instrumentation
- Active filters and audio processing
- Data acquisition systems
Quality and Reliability
Texas Instruments is known for its commitment to quality, and the TLV2452IDGKR is no exception. It is designed to meet the stringent requirements of industrial and commercial applications. The device's robust design ensures reliable performance over its entire temperature range, from -40°C to 125°C.
Ordering Information
The product is available in tape and reel packaging, making it suitable for automated assembly processes. The orderable part number is TLV2452IDGKR, and it is RoHS compliant, adhering to environmental standards.
